## Deploying the Gatewick Proctor Queue

Deploys are pretty painless: push to main, wait for the pipeline, then watch the queue drain dashboard for five minutes. If candidates pile up mid-exam, roll back first and ask questions later — the queue replays safely. Everything the workers care about lives in one config block, shown here for reference.

settings of bafof-yagef:
JOROX_PIN=8740
JOROX_TENANT=pelox
JOROX_METRICS_HOST=metrics.jorox.qorvelworks.internal
JOROX_SEAL=seal_c78f63c1
JOROX_STANDBY_TEAM=norax

## Authentication — Thumbwright Queue

All producers and consumers of the thumbnail generation queue authenticate against the Thumbwright gateway. Tokens are scoped per-pipeline; don't share across teams. Rotation is monthly, automated. For the demo during the weekly sync, the staging queue accepts a single shared credential with enqueue and dequeue scopes. Flagging here so nobody burns time minting their own: the staging key is below.

gateway credential: kto23_LX9A4ys6i4nzHtpOLNLodKK

## Authentication

Heads up: the nightly reindex job (`reindex_nightly.py`) talks to the Lanternfish search cluster, and that cluster won't accept anonymous writes anymore — we locked it down last sprint. The job now authenticates as the `reindex-runner` service identity against Corvid Gateway, and the token is injected via the `LF_INDEX_TOKEN` env var in the scheduler config. Nothing clever going on, just a bearer header on every batch request. For review purposes, the staging credential currently in use is listed below.

service key, kadug-kadup: kto15_rN23XLAYImmZgrJ

INTERNAL MEMO — Restricted

To the incoming director: Pellward Industries is evaluating the acquisition of Brightlark Tooling. Diligence is 60% complete. Valuation range holds; no material liabilities found to date. Staffing overlap is limited to two functions. Decision expected within six weeks. Context for the board's position appears in the note directly below.

internal memo for hahif-hahaf: Headcount on the Zorwyn team goes from 9 to 100 by the end of October. Gross margin on Zorwyn came in at 5 percent against a plan of 10 percent.